The Role of a Car Locksmith

A car locksmith specializes in supplying security options for lorries, consisting of key replacement, lock setup, and emergency situation lockout support. Unlike a basic locksmith who deals with a variety of locks, an automotive locksmith focuses entirely on the detailed systems found in cars, trucks, and other lorries. These professionals are geared up with the latest tools and technology to handle a wide variety of automotive security needs.

Common Services Offered by Car Locksmiths

  1. Key Replacement and Duplication

    • Lost or Stolen Keys: If you've misplaced your keys or they have actually been stolen, a car locksmith can offer a brand-new set. They utilize customized devices to produce exact duplicates of your original keys.
    • Broken Keys: Sometimes, keys break inside the lock, making it impossible to eliminate them. An expert locksmith can extract the broken key and create a brand-new one.
  2. Keyless Entry and Ignition Systems

    • Programing Key Fobs: Modern automobiles often feature keyless entry systems. A car locksmith can program and replace key fobs, guaranteeing that your vehicle's electronic components function perfectly.
    • Ignition Interlock Devices: For chauffeurs with a history of DUI, ignition interlock devices are sometimes mandated by law. A car locksmith can install and keep these devices.
  3. Lock Installation and Repair

    • New Locks: If your vehicle's locks are harmed or malfunctioning, a car locksmith can set up new ones.
    • Lock Repair: Rather than changing locks, a locksmith can often repair them, saving you time and cash.
  4. Emergency Situation Lockout Assistance

    • 24/7 Service: Being locked out of your car can happen at any time. Numerous car locksmiths use 24/7 emergency services to assist you get back on the roadway quickly.
    • Expert Tools: They use specialized tools to open your vehicle without triggering damage, which is particularly essential for newer designs with complex security systems.
  5. High-Security Locks and Keys

    • Transponder Keys: These keys consist of a chip that communicates with the car's computer system. G28 Car Keys can program and replace these keys.
    • Laser-Cut Keys: Some high-end automobiles use laser-cut keys for enhanced security. A professional locksmith can create these keys utilizing exact laser-cutting technology.

Tips for Avoiding Lockout Situations

  1. Keep an Extra Key

    • Always keep a spare key in a safe place, such as a lock box at home or with a trusted good friend or member of the family.
  2. Regular Maintenance

    • Have your vehicle's locks and keys checked regularly. Worn keys or harmed locks can result in lockout circumstances.
  3. Utilize a Key Fob Case

    • Protect your key fob from damage by utilizing a durable case. This can prevent the key fob from breaking or malfunctioning.
  4. Stay Calm

    • If you do discover yourself locked out, stay calm. Stressing can result in bad decisions, such as attempting to burglarize your vehicle, which can cause damage.
